Year 11 & 12

In Years 11 & 12 we will offer students both Senior Secondary Pathway options; the Victorian Certificate of Education (VCE), including the Vocational Major (VM) and the Victorian Pathways Certificate.

Detailed information about these options can be found on the Victorian Curriculum and Assessment Authority website. We will add Brinbeal Secondary College specific information as we add each year level.

Health & Human Development Unit 1 & 2

VCE Health and Human Development takes a broad and multidimensional approach to defining and understanding health. Students examine health (including the concepts of health and wellbeing, and health status) and human development as dynamic concepts that are subject to a complex interplay of biological, sociocultural and environmental factors, many of which can be acted upon by people, communities and governments. Students consider the interaction between these factors and learn that health and human development is complex and influenced by the settings in which people are born, grow, live, work and age.

Areas of Study:

Unit 1:

  • AOS 1: Concepts of Health

  • AOS 2: Youth Health and Wellbeing

  • AOS 3: Health and Nutrition

Unit 2:

  • AOS 1: Developmental Transitions

  • AOS 2: Youth Health Literacy

Assessment:

  • Five AOS school-based assessment tasks

  • Two end of unit exams

Pathways: VCE Health and Human Development Unit 3 & 4

Tertiary Pathways: Nursing and Midwifery, Allied Health, Biomedical Science and Medicine

Business Management Unit 1 & 2

Business Management examines the ways businesses manage resources to achieve objectives, most notably profit. Follow the process of creating a business from the initial idea, through to the day-to-day management of a business. Identify business opportunities and motives, set your goals, identify business needs and threats and opportunities, market your products, and manage staff. By studying Business Management, students will analyse real-world case studies to see how businesses succeed or fail, discuss questions of ethics and social responsibility, and propose business ideas.

Areas of Study:

Unit 1:

  • AOS 1: The business Idea

  • AOS 2: Internal business environment

  • AOS 3: External business environment

Unit 2:

  • AOS 1: Legal Requirements

  • AOS 2: Marketing a business

  • AOS 3: Staffing a business

Assessment:

  • Six AOS school-based assessment tasks

  • Two end of unit exams

Pathways: VCE Business Management Unit 3 & 4

Tertiary Pathways: Commerce, Business, Management, Marketing & Human resources

General Mathematics Unit 1 & 2

General Mathematics Unit 1 and 2 caters for a range of student interests. Students are expected to be able to apply techniques, routines and processes involving rational and real arithmetic, sets, lists, tables and matrices, diagrams and geometric constructions, algorithms, algebraic manipulation, recurrence relations, equations and graphs, with and without the use of technology. They should have facility with relevant mental and by-hand approaches to estimation and computation. The use of numerical, graphical, geometric, symbolic, financial and statistical functionality of technology for teaching and learning mathematics, for working mathematically, and in related assessment, is incorporated throughout each unit.

Areas of Study:

Unit 1:

  • AOS1: Data analysis, probability and statistics

  • AOS2: Algebra, number and structure

  • AOS3: Functions, relations and graphs

  • AOS4: Discrete mathematics

Unit 2:

  • AOS1: Data analysis, probability and statistics

  • AOS2: Discrete mathematics

  • AOS3: Functions, relations and graphs

  • AOS4: Space and Measurement

Assessment:

  • Eight AOS school-based assessment tasks, including two Mathematical investigations

  • Two end of unit exams

Pathways: VCE General Maths Unit 3 & 4 or VCE Foundation Maths Unit 3 & 4

Tertiary Pathways: Education, Health - nursing or biomedicine, Science

Biology Unit 1 & 2

Biology is the study of living things and how they have changed and evolved over time. It looks at how living things work, how they interact with each other and their environment, and how they survive and reproduce. In Biology, students explore life at different levels, from tiny molecules and cells to whole organisms. They learn how living things carry out life processes and how they continue to survive and pass on their characteristics. By studying Biology, students develop an understanding of how different parts of life are connected. They can see how ideas within Biology link together and how Biology connects with other areas of science.

Areas of Study:

Unit 1:

  • AOS1: How do cells function?

  • AOS2: How do plant and animal systems function?

  • AOS3: How do scientific investigations develop understanding of how organisms regulate their functions?

Unit 2:

  • AOS1: How is inheritance explained?

  • AOS2: How do inherited adaptations impact on diversity?

  • AOS3: How do humans use science to explore and communicate contemporary bioethical issues?

Assessment:

  • Six AOS school-based assessment tasks

  • Two end of unit exams

Pathways: VCE Biology Unit 3 & 4

Tertiary Pathways: Nursing and Midwifery, Allied Health, Biomedical Science and Medicine
